Effects of Cold Weather on Your Water Heater

During the winter months, the cold weather can freeze the pipes connected to your water heater. When water freezes in the pipes, it restricts the flow and can cause the system to shut down. This freeze-up can also cause damage to internal components, making the heater malfunction or even break down. Keeping your water heater and pipes insulated can help avoid these cold weather effects.

The external temperature can also cause your water heater’s components to become sluggish. This can slow down the heating process, resulting in long waits for hot water. The combination of frozen pipes and slower performance can contribute to more significant problems if not addressed quickly. Insulating your water heater and pipes will guarantee better efficiency during the cold months.

Insufficient Power Supply and Its Impact

A common reason for a water heater not working in winter is an insufficient power supply. Cold temperatures can cause electrical connections to weaken or fail entirely. If your water heater is electric, the extreme cold can impact the heating elements, making it difficult for the water heater to work effectively. Checking the electrical connections regularly will help prevent these issues.

Gas-powered water heaters can also be impacted by weather conditions. A gas leak or a malfunctioning thermostat can cause a lack of power. Regular maintenance guarantees that both electrical and gas-powered water heaters are running properly, reducing the risk of an emergency breakdown in the middle of winter.

Faulty Thermostat Settings Can Affect Heating

A thermostat that’s set incorrectly can lead to a water heater not working in winter. If the temperature is set too low, the water heater may not heat the water to the desired level. This problem can be especially common if the thermostat is old or malfunctioning. Resetting the thermostat or replacing it with a new model can restore the system’s heating performance.

Another issue is a thermostat that becomes uncalibrated. If this happens, the heater may keep turning off prematurely or fail to reach a high enough temperature. This can lead to cold showers and other heating issues. A technician can quickly adjust or replace the thermostat to ensure it’s working properly.

Broken or Frozen Pipes Leading to Heater Issues

Frozen or broken pipes can cause significant disruptions in your water heater system. During winter, when the temperature drops, water inside the pipes can freeze and block the flow of water to your water heater. This results in a water heater not working in winter. Insulated pipes help prevent freezing, but if pipes do freeze, they can burst, causing leaks and further damage.

If pipes are broken or severely damaged, it’s important to get professional help. A plumbing expert can locate the issue and fix it, ensuring that your water heater gets the water it needs to function properly. Keeping pipes insulated and properly maintained can help avoid these costly and inconvenient problems.

Gas Supply Problems and Water Heater Malfunctions

Gas-powered water heaters rely on a steady supply of gas to function. A disruption in the gas supply can cause the heater to malfunction. In winter, ice or snow buildup can block gas lines, leading to a water heater not working in winter. If the pilot light keeps going out or the heater isn’t producing hot water, it could be a sign of a gas supply issue.

Gas valves and connections can also degrade over time, especially in cold conditions, preventing gas from flowing to the heater. Regular inspection of gas lines and connections can help identify potential issues before they affect your water heater. Professional repairs are necessary to restore proper function and prevent safety hazards.

Issues with Water Heater Age and Efficiency

As your water heater ages, its efficiency naturally decreases. Older units often struggle to keep up with demands, especially during the colder months. The components wear down, leading to increased energy consumption and slower heating. These inefficiencies can result in cold showers, poor water temperature control, and higher energy bills. Upgrading or replacing the heater can restore both efficiency and comfort.

The age of your water heater can also affect its ability to withstand harsh winter conditions. Parts like the heating element or thermostat may wear out, leading to failures. Regular maintenance and early replacement can prevent these issues. If your water heater is over ten years old, consider a professional inspection to assess its performance.

Regular Maintenance to Prevent Winter Problems

Winter problems can often be avoided with regular maintenance. A well-maintained water heater performs more efficiently and is less likely to break down in cold weather. Flushing the tank, checking the thermostat, and inspecting the pipes can help prevent issues like freezing and mineral buildup. Routine checks ensure that your water heater works when you need it most.

Maintaining the heater involves more than just cleaning; it’s about checking all components for wear and tear. During the winter, your water heater faces more stress, making it crucial to schedule an annual service. A professional will inspect the entire system, identify potential issues, and fix them before they lead to expensive breakdowns.
